Black bean and corn enchiladas are hearty, filling, satisfying, and delicious. These enchiladas are my kids' favorite, but easy to spice up to your liking. They're easy to make naturally vegetarian, vegan, or gluten-free
Ingredients For Black Bean And Corn Enchiladas Recipe
1 tablespoon Olive oil
1 Green bell pepper, seeded and chopped
15 ounce Crushed Tomatoes
2 tablespoon Taco Seasoning
3 cup Cooked drained black beans
1 can Corn, Drained
8 Favorite tortillas
1 cup Shredded cheddar cheese, dairy free
1 Batch homemade easy enchilada sauce
1 Large avocado, sliced for serving
1 Head romaine or iceberg lettuce, shredded for serving
1 Small red onion, thinly sliced
